Abstract Purpose of Review Long-term survival has increased significantly in breast cancer patients, and cardiovascular side effects are surpassing cancer-related mortality. We summarize risk factors, prevention strategies, detection, and management of cardiotoxicity, with focus on left ventricular dysfunction and heart failure, during breast cancer treatment. Recent Findings Baseline treatment of cardiovascular risk factors is recommended. Anthracycline and trastuzumab treatment constitute a substantial risk of developing cardiotoxicity. There is growing evidence that this can be treated with beta blockers and angiotensin antagonists. Early detection of cardiotoxicity with cardiac imaging and circulating cardiovascular biomarkers is currently evaluated in clinical trials. Chest wall irradiation accelerates atherosclerotic processes and induces fibrosis. Immune checkpoint inhibitors require consideration for surveillance due to a small risk of severe myocarditis. Cyclin-dependent kinases4/6 inhibitors, cyclophosphamide, taxanes, tyrosine kinase inhibitors, and endocrine therapy have a lower-risk profile for cardiotoxicity. Summary Preventive and management strategies to counteract cancer treatment–related left ventricular dysfunction or heart failure in breast cancer patients should include a comprehensive cardiovascular risk assessment and individual clinical evaluation. This should include both patient and treatment-related factors. Further clinical trials especially on early detection, cardioprevention, and management are urgently needed.

Background: Sympathetic hyperactivity is one of the several factors that influence left ventricular dyssynchrony post anthracycline. Cardiovascular risk factors affect the acceleration of left ventricular dyssynchrony. The purpose of this study is to assess the difference in correlation coefficient between HRV and mechanical dispersion in breast cancer patients with and without cardiovascular risk factors after anthracycline administration.Method: This was a cross sectional study with linear regression analysis conducted at Hasan Sadikin General Hospital Bandung between July-October 2018. Subjects were breast cancer patients who had received 6 cycles of FAS and were divided into 2 groups. Group I was patients with breast cancer who have cardiovascular risk factors and group II was without cardiovascular risk factors. Sympathetic hyperactivity was assessed using HRV baseline frequency with minimum duration of recording and left ventricular dyssynchrony was assessed using MD method by echocardiography.Result: This study involved 66 patients. Group I (n=34, age 50.3±6.3 years) and group II (n=32, age 48.5±9 years). The median of LF/HF ratio was 2.7 ms2 (group I) and 1.9 ms2 (group II). MD value in group I and group II was 52.2±13.6 ms and 45.7±8.8 ms, respectively. The result of linear regression analysis showed positive correlation between the LF/HF ratio and MD in group I (r=0.546, p=0.001) and group II (r=0.423, p=0.016) after adjusting three confounding factors (systolic blood pressure, cumulative dose of Doxorubicin, and age).Conclusion: Correlation coefficient of HRV with mechanical dispersion in post anthracycline breast cancer patients in those with cardiovascular risk factorswas worse compared to those without cardiovascular risk factors but was not statistically significant.

Anthracycline-based regimens with or without anti-human epidermal growth factor receptor (HER) 2 agents such as trastuzumab are effective in breast cancer treatment. Nevertheless, heart failure (HF) has become a significant side effect of these regimens. This study aimed to investigate the incidence and factors associated with HF in breast cancer patients treated with anthracyclines with or without trastuzumab. A retrospective cohort study was performed in patients with breast cancer who were treated with anthracyclines with or without trastuzumab between 1 January 2014 and 31 December 2018. The primary outcome was the incidence of HF. The secondary outcome was the risk factors associated with HF by using the univariable and multivariable cox-proportional hazard model. A total of 475 breast cancer patients were enrolled with a median follow-up time of 2.88 years (interquartile range (IQR), 1.59–3.93). The incidence of HF was 3.2%, corresponding to an incidence rate of 11.1 per 1000 person-years. The increased risk of HF was seen in patients receiving a combination of anthracycline and trastuzumab therapy, patients treated with radiotherapy or palliative-intent chemotherapy, and baseline left ventricular ejection fraction <65%, respectively. There were no statistically significant differences in other risk factors for HF, such as age, cardiovascular comorbidities, and cumulative doxorubicin dose. In conclusion, the incidence of HF was consistently high in patients receiving combination anthracyclines trastuzumab regimens. A reduced baseline left ventricular ejection fraction, radiotherapy, and palliative-intent chemotherapy were associated with an increased risk of HF. Intensive cardiac monitoring in breast cancer patients with an increased risk of HF should be advised to prevent undesired cardiac outcomes.

561 Background: Adjuvant trastuzumab (T)-based chemotherapy has been shown to reduce relapse and improve survival in breast cancer patients but has been associated with increased risks of cardiotoxicity. Our study aims to define the incidence and severity of cardiotoxicity amongst Asian breast cancer patients. Methods: This is a retrospective review of patients who have received adjuvant T from June 2005 to 2007. Cardiotoxicity was defined as a drop in left ventricular ejection fraction (LVEF) to less than 50% and/or reduction of > 10% of baseline. Cardiovascular (CVS) risk factors were defined as having a family history or presence of CAD, hypertension, diabetes mellitus, hyperlipidemia and smoking. We used pair sampled t-test to evaluate the mean LVEF change and Chi-square test to evaluate the association of cardiotoxicity and demographics. Results: There were 179 female patients. Cardiotoxicity was reported in 70 (39.1%), of whom 59 had asymptomatic decline in LVEF and 11 experienced CHF. Mean LVEF, comparing various time points (3, 6, 9 and 12 months) against baseline showed statistically significant decline (p<0.05). T was withheld (n=33) due to asymptomatic decline in LVEF (n=24), symptomatic heart failure (n=4) and both (n=5). Twenty-one with resolution of CHF (n=7) or LVEF recovery (n=14) were rechallenged. Cardiotoxicity recurred in 9 - asymptomatic decline in LVEF (n=8) and recurrent CHF (n=1). There were no cardiac-related deaths. Neither patient demographics nor CVS risk factors predicted for cardiotoxicity. Conclusions: This is one of the largest series reported in Asians receiving T. As previously reported, T-induced cardiotoxicity resulted in mostly asymptomatic reversible decline in LVEF. Our incidence of cardiotoxicity appeared higher (39.1%) in Asians and more importantly, almost half of the patients experienced cardiotoxicity upon rechallenge. It would be prudent to explore whether there is any difference in susceptibility to T-induced cardiotoxicity between the different races. 11508 Background: Cardiovascular-disease risk factors (CVD-RFs) increase the risk of cardiac events in women undergoing chemotherapy. Less is known about the impact of CVD-RFs on healthcare utilization and costs. Methods: We examined breast cancer patients treated uniformly on SWOG clinical trials from 1999-2011. We identified baseline diabetes, hypertension, hypercholesterolemia, and coronary artery disease (CAD) by linking trial records to Medicare claims; obesity was identified using clinical records. The outcomes were emergency room visits (ER), hospitalizations and costs. Multivariable logistic and linear regression were used. Results: Among the 708 patients included in the analysis, 160 (22.6%) experienced 234 separate hospitalizations, and 193 (27.3%) experienced 311 separate ER visits. Diabetes, hypertension, hypercholesterolemia, and CAD were all associated with increased risk of hospitalizations and ER visit. Hypertension had the strongest association, with more than a threefold risk of hospitalization for those with hypertension compared to those without (OR [95% CI], 3.16 [1.85-5.40], p<0.001). For those with ≥3 CVD-RFs, the risk of hospitalization was greater compared to 0 or 1 CVD-RFs (OR [95% CI], 2.74 [1.71-4.38], p<0.001). Similar results were seen for ER visits. In the first 12 months after trial registration, patients with diabetes ($38,324 vs $30,923, 23.9% increase, p=0.05), hypercholesterolemia ($34,168 vs $30,661, 11.4% increase, p=0.02), and CAD ($37,781 vs $31,698, 19.2% increase, p=0.04) had statistically significantly higher total healthcare costs. Additionally, those with 2 significant CVD-RFs ($35,353 vs. $28,899, 22.3% increase, p=.005) had higher total healthcare costs. Conclusions: Our study demonstrates that the presence of both CVD-RFs and ER visits and hospitalizations are frequent among elderly BC patients. The risk of ER visits and hospitalizations is higher among patients with CVD-RFs, and increases with the number of RFs. Better management of CVD-RFs and more aggressive symptom management may be required to reduce both physical and financial toxicities to elderly patients undergoing BC therapy.
